Difference:

- Rackless Focuser (AC versions): FSB-125C rackless focuser with precision bearing guides and a classic Crayford-style mechanism for smooth focusing and stable optical alignment—ideal for light-load manual imaging.
- Rack-and-Pinion Focuser (AR versions): FSB-125R gear-driven focuser with precision bearing guides for higher focusing accuracy; compatible with ToupTek Astro AAF electronic focuser, suitable for autofocus and heavier payloads.

PAPO Apochromatic Optical Design, True Star-Color Reproduction:

- The GS Series guide scopes feature a proprietary three-element PAPO (planar apochromat with integrated field flattener) configuration with one ED element, effectively correcting chromatic aberration, astigmatism, and field curvature. Designed around a flat, well-corrected 1-inch image circle, they deliver crisp, pinpoint star images for accurate guiding, while also supporting visual use and entry-level night-sky/DSO imaging.

High-Transmission Coatings + Anti-Reflection Threads, Boost Guiding Sensitivity:
- All optical surfaces use broadband multi-layer AR coatings to minimize reflections and maximize transmission. The internal barrel is precision-machined with anti-reflection threads and additional stray-light suppression, greatly improving image contrast.

CNC Precision Machining, Fine Matte Finish:
- The tube, rings, and dovetail plate are CNC-machined from aluminum alloy for a balance of low weight and structural strength. Anodized surfaces provide wear and corrosion resistance suited to field astronomy. The fine matte texture is comfortable, durable, and non-slip.

Modular Structure for Maximum Flexibility:
- A proprietary universal M48 extension tube with anti-reflection treatment forms the main barrel, allowing flexible combinations to match optical path requirements - from visual observing to astrophotography.

Wide Compatibility · Rich Configurations, Seamless System Integration:
- Built for flexibility: support for 1-inch sensors, direct threaded connections, and multiple mounting points let the GS Series integrate smoothly with a wide range of cameras and setups.
